In his monologue, the Ghost of Hamlet's father says the following about Claudius, Hamlet's mother, and his own death:
- The Ghost calls Claudius an incestuous and treacherous animal. He is filled with resentment and wants Hamlet to kill Claudius to avenge his death.
- As for Gertrude, Hamlet's mother, the Ghost says he loved her, but also that she is lustful. He sees her as having fallen from grace.
- Finally, he says his own death was unnatural, and that he was killed without the chance of repenting for his sins.
<h3>Who is the Ghost in Hamlet?</h3>
- The Ghost that appears a few times in the story is Hamlet's father, King Hamlet, who was poisoned to death by his own brother, Claudius. He is now asking his son to avenge him.
- King Hamlet is stuck in purgatory since he was not able to repent for his sins. He is also quite resentful toward not only Claudius but also his wife, Gertrude, who married Claudius after his death.
- It is the Ghost that sets the story in motion. His revelation to Hamlet gets this character to change the way he acts and affect everyone around him.
